William Clarke

William Clarke Notable

b. October 18, 1868 · Baltimore Orioles 1893–1898, Boston Beaneaters 1899–1900, Washington Senators 1901–1904, New York Giants 1905

William Clarke played for four clubs across 13 seasons as a catcher, opening with the Baltimore Orioles in 1893 and closing with the New York Giants in 1905.

Across 950 games he batted .256, with 858 hits and 394 runs. He finished with 20 home runs, 110 doubles and 54 stolen bases.

He played 739 games behind the plate, with 2,587 putouts and 190 errors. He turned 66 double plays. He also played 193 games at first base.

He was born in New York, NY, USA on October 18, 1868, and died on July 29, 1959. He batted right-handed and threw right-handed.
